The clouds cleared and the sun came out in time to celebrate Oldenburg Family Dentistry with a ribbon cutting ceremony Tuesday at its Wisconsin Avenue location.
City of Vicksburg Ward 2 Alderman Alex Monsour opened the ceremony on behalf of the mayor and alderman, expressing appreciation for the commitment Oldenburg has made to healthcare in Vicksburg.
Dr. Chandler Oldenburg is a Vicksburg native who graduated from Warren Central High School. She attended University of
Arkansas and received her Doctor of Dental Medicine from UMMC School of Dentistry. During her time at UMMC, she received many awards for her outstanding performance, including the American College of Dentists Outstanding Leadership Award, the ASDA Excellence Award and the Trailblazer Award.
Oldenburg has taken over the practice formerly run by longtime local dentist, Dr. Martin Chaney. She began shadowing him in dental school, then worked with him, and now owns the practice.
“I’m really thankful,” Oldenburg said. “I really shadowed him (Chaney) from second year dental school. I watched how he did things, how he spoke to patients.”
Chaney continues to work at the office three days a week. According to Oldenburg, “there’s no plan for him to stop doing that. I’m happy that he’s here. I’m thankful that he’s trusted me. He started this practice.”
Chaney adds that he started the business “with one chair in 1983.” His work with Oldenburg began during her time in dental school and also when they both volunteered at a free clinic in Vicksburg.
“I’m just tickled she came back to Vicksburg. She could have gone anywhere. We’re glad to have her,” he said, adding, “I love it now more than ever.”
Oldenburg said she is glad to be in Vicksburg.
“There was no question where we would go,” she said of coming back to the River City. “This is home.”
Oldenburg Family Dentistry is located at 3205 Wisconsin Avenue and is open Monday through Thursday from 8 a.m. to 5 p.m. and Friday from 8 a.m. until noon. The practice specializes in family and cosmetic dental services with an emphasis on preventative oral health.
